Hello,
I have two lcd monitors, one 19'(1280x1024) and another 15' rotated (768x1024)
19' is on my left and 15' on my right.
Only the left monitor is able to rotate. If I choose to rotate the other one, I
get some (random?) trash memory (in my case, part of my desktop in the last X
session before soft reboot)
I tried to set 'Option "Rotate" "Left"' in Monitor xorg.conf but in any
combination it crashed/freezes X on startup (monitor leds blinks)
I'm using 0.10.1.20080424 on opensuse. I didn't found any newer nouveau build
for opensuse11.0.
